Pass all ECU students this semester due to COVID-19

The Issue

Due to the outstanding amounts of Coronavirus outbreaks, universities like ECU are being forced to finish their courses online. Many of the classes students take are already challenging  as they were. And now it may be even more difficult for students to pass due to no access to internet or the environment at home. I along with other students believe that passing us this semester would benefit everyone. 

Virtual instruction for the duration of the semester would cause a great deal of difficulty for students to receive the attention they need from professors. There have been many instances where students have communicated to professors, but the students wouldn't receive any help. With virtual instruction in place, this prevents meetings with professors and teacher assistants in person. While we can still interact with our professors and teacher assistants via email, phone, and video-calling, there are limitations including one's time zone,and wireless internet availability that need to be in consideration. This puts a strain on students who are in self quarantine especially, due to the fact that although they may be able to access everything through the internet, they aren’t focused on recovery and safety precautions. This implements the problem that schools don’t want to keep the health and safety of their students their primary goal. There are students who prefer in-person instruction rather than online instruction due to their own self-discipline and educational habits. Forcibly having to adhere to these circumstances will greatly affect their performance within their studies. This also jeopardizes the mental health of students who have to continue doing school work, "attending" class, and figuring out when to eat and sleep while maintaining a regularity that is not possible with this system.

Furthermore, the university has done a great job providing limited dining, recreation, and student activities for the students who have resided on campus throughout spring break. However, the next step that is needed for East CarolinaUniversity to take every single undergraduate, graduate, professional, and certificate students into consideration when making a firm decision on courses for the remainder of the semester. Offering a pass option for classes for the Spring 2020 semester helps alleviate some of the stresses caused by measures taken to prevent the spread of COVID-19, and will allow students, as well as administrators, advisors, and instructors to further focus on taking the necessary precautions during this epidemic.
